May Improve Blood Sugar Levels

Intermittent fasting is generally associated with improving blood sugar control and insulin sensitivity . A pilot study done in 2017 showed that fasting for 18 to 20 hours a day could lead to weight loss and post-meal blood sugar control . This shows that fasting could be extremely beneficial to patients with type 2 diabetes. However, if you are suffering from this disease, please talk to your doctor before trying the 20-hour fast, or any other form of intermittent fasting.

    Are You Eating Too Much When Youre Not Fasting What Are You Eating

    How Much Weight Can I Lose In A Week With Intermittent ...

    Could you be over-eating on your non-fast days ? If you have lost a fair amount of weight already, you will need less food to sustain your body and so you need to reduce how much you eat on the non-fast days in line with your new energy requirements . Fasting tends to reduce our appetites on the non-fast days, but some days we are hungrier than others. Perhaps the hungry days are coming too often? Some people find that adding an extra fast day or extending the length of the fasting period can be enough to bring appetite back under control.

    If you have insulin resistance you may be particularly sensitive to carbohydrates in your diet, particularly sugar and refined carbohydrates, such as white flour, white pasta and white rice. Carbohydrates stimulate our bodies to release insulin which prevents us from burning our fat stores. Many of our FastDay forum members have found that reducing their carbohydrate intake has helped with weight loss. It is not necessary to go on an extreme low carbohydrate diet, but avoiding carbohydrates on fast days and reducing carbohydrate intake on non-fast days can make a difference.

    FastDay says: attention to your Way of Eating when not fasting may be enough to break the plateau.

    Intermittent Fasting: What Is It And Is It Safe

    Intermittent fasting may seem like a recent trend, but actually, humans have periodically refrained from eating for millennia for a host of reasons: Believe it or not, physicians of yesteryear used to prescribe fasting to treat a host of ailments, while ancient philosophers pushed their plates away in attempts to boost their mental clarity. Fasting has also been a form of political protestthink: the hunger strikes of Mahatma Gandhi, Irish Republican prisoners in the 1980s, or British and American suffragettes in the early 1900s.

    To this day, avoiding food is a regular part of many religions. Traditionally, Muslims forgo food and beverage during daylight throughout Ramadan Jews skip eating and drinking on Yom Kippur and Hindus and Buddhists fast weekly.

    Now fasting is trickling into the secular spotlight due to media coverage that claims intermittent fasting not only leads to weight loss and boosts metabolism but that it may also curtail cancer risk and even extend lifespan.

    But is intermittent fasting, a practice thats both ancient and newly trendy, as effective as some attest? Below, we take a closer look.

    Lowers The Risk Of Type Ii Diabetes

    Since being overweight and obese are two of the main risk factors for developing type II diabetes, intermittent fasting could have an effect on diabetes prevention due to its weight loss effects. It can also potentially influence other factors linked to an increased risk of diabetes. A 2014 study showed that intermittent fasting can lower blood glucose and insulin levels in people at risk of diabetes .

    As weve said, not all weight loss is the same. Its essential to make sure youre losing weight in a healthy way. Can intermittent fasting help with healthy weight loss?

    Here, the data are conflicting.

    On one hand, intermittent fasting can help improve metabolic health by reducing blood sugar and blood pressure while also improving blood lipid levels.4

    On the other hand, two trials suggested that intermittent fasting may not lead to greater weight loss than usual care, or even worse may lead to greater loss of lean muscle mass than usual care or continuous calorie restriction.5

    A healthy weight loss intervention also should be relatively easy to comply with and maintain long-term. Fortunately, intermittent fasting may fit that criteria.

    One study reported that working adults found time-restricted eating with an eight-hour eating window easy to comply with and maintain for three months.6

    That fits with frequent clinical experience suggesting many people easily adapt to time-restricted eating, especially when they follow a low-carb or high-protein diet that helps improve satiety and reduce appetite.7

    So, in terms of convenience and ease in your approach to healthy weight loss, intermittent fasting seems to be a winner.

    How Much Weight Can You Lose On 1: 8 Diet

    To lose weight on the 16:8 diet, its important to match the fasting with healthy eating and exercise. If done so correctly, theres a typical weight loss of around seven to 11 pounds over a ten week period. This is according to a review of 40 different studies published in Molecular and Cellular Endocrincology who found that on average, someone weighing just over 90kg would lose 5% of their total body weight in the ten week period.

    A 2018 study published in the Journal of Nutrition and Healthy Eating revealed that the 16:8 diet plan can help people lose weight, without having to count calories as the 8-hour fast produces the same kind of calorific restriction and weight loss.

    However, whether theres a distinct weight loss advantage achieved on the 16:8 diet compared to other diets remains to be seen. Some studies have demonstrated that theres almost no difference between people who do intermittent fasting compared those who count calories and cut back on unhealthy food.
